Cloud cover reduces nocturnal radiative cooling, elevating overnight lows compared to clearer nights, while scattered showers and high humidity maintain moderate temperatures by limiting daytime heating and enhancing downward longwave radiation. Urban heat island effects in central Tokyo stations can add 1–2°C relative to rural areas, but models show minor variations based on exact wind flow and precipitation timing. Historical July minima average near 23°C, yet the current pattern—post-plum rain season transition with frequent cloudiness—favors slightly cooler readings.
